Introduction:

The George Washington University (GW) women’s basketball team secured a 63-59 victory over the University of Delaware on December 10, 2023, marking their fourth consecutive win – the program’s longest winning streak since the 2022-23 season. https://gwsports.com/news/2023/12/10/womens-basketball-revolutionaries-defeat-blue-hens-63-59.aspx The game showcased a strong offensive performance led by Sara Lewis, and a resilient defensive effort that has characterized the team’s recent success.

Game summary

The Revolutionaries established an early lead, fueled by a dominant first quarter from Sara Lewis, who scored 10 of GW’s 18 points. GW continued to build on this momentum in the second quarter, outscoring Delaware 11-8 to take a 29-21 lead into halftime. https://gwsports.com/news/2023/12/10/womens-basketball-revolutionaries-defeat-blue-hens-63-59.aspx

Despite Delaware’s efforts to close the gap in the second half, GW maintained control of the game. Key three-pointers from Kamari Sims and Gabby Reynolds proved crucial in securing the victory.

Key Player Performances

* Sara Lewis: Led all scorers with a career-high 22 points and added 7 rebounds and 2 steals. https://gwsports.com/news/2023/12/10/womens-basketball-revolutionaries-defeat-blue-hens-63-59.aspx

* Kamari Sims: Contributed 16 points, including crucial shots down the stretch. https://gwsports.com/news/2023/12/10/womens-basketball-revolutionaries-defeat-blue-hens-63-59.aspx

* Gabby Reynolds: scored 12 points and grabbed 7 rebounds. https://gwsports.com/news/2023/12/10/womens-basketball-revolutionaries-defeat-blue-hens-63-59.aspx

* Tanah Becker: Led the team in rebounding with 8 boards. https://gwsports.com/news/2023/12/10/womens-basketball-revolutionaries-defeat-blue-hens-63-59.aspx

Team Statistics and Trends

With this win, GW’s record improves to 6-5 overall. During their four-game winning streak, the Revolutionaries have demonstrated improved defensive play, limiting opponents to an average of 54 points per game and outscoring them by an average of 8.8 points.https://gwsports.com/news/2023/12/10/womens-basketball-revolutionaries-defeat-blue-hens-63-59.aspx
